Abstract
The electrochemical behaviors of pyrolized polyacrylonitrile (PAN) were investigated to be applied as a carbon source in a metal-carbon composite anode in Li-ion batteries. Pyrolized PAN showed a porous structure with a reversible capacity approximately 300 mA h g(-1). A pyrolyzed PAN based Sn/C composites were synthesized from SnO and PAN using a high energy ball milling followed by carbothermal reduction, and the Sn particles with diameters of 100-200 nm were randomly embedded on the carbon matrix. The composite electrode exhibited a relatively large capacity and an excellent cycle behavior. The enhanced electrochemical performances of this composite were attributed to the role as a matrix and porous nature of pyrolyzed PAN which accommodated a large volume expansion of the Sn during the reaction with Li, the increased electrical conductivity of pyrolyzed PAN and the uniformly dispersed nanometer sized Sn that formed during the cycling.
